Summary

Depression and psychosis in adolescents and emerging adults have a significant economic, health, and social burden on an international scale. Targeting transdiagnostic factors that are common across disorders, and doing so early before symptoms develop or worsen, is critical to maximise impact and get more bang for buck. Anhedonia, the pervasive inability to anticipate and experience pleasure or interest, is a transdiagnostic feature of depression and psychosis. Anhedonia has received comparatively little research attention compared to other symptoms, meaning that it is not well understood or addressed in therapy. The current research will use existing high-quality datasets in an ambitious exploration of the emotional processes related to anhedonia in depression and psychosis, with a focus on adolescents and emerging adults. It will extend prior research by using advanced real-time methodologies that provide a fine-grained and temporal understanding of emotional experiences in anhedonia in daily life. This approach will dramatically advance the field by aiding the future development of transdiagnostic techniques targeting anhedonia that are more effective than those currently available.
